Description AWS Training & Certification is looking for an experienced technical program management (TPM) leader who is passionate about transforming education. We're seeking an experienced TPM leader to drive successful product launches, beta programs, and go-to-market strategies. This role will serve as the central coordinator between Engineering, Product, Marketing, Sales, and Customer Success teams to ensure seamless product releases and maximum impact. The successful candidate must have exceptional problem-solving skills, strong business judgement, deep technical understanding, and demonstrated experience influencing both internally, and externally at all levels as well as proven ability to execute both strategically, and tactically. This position requires a candidate who is customer focused with a passion for new, ambiguous, industry-defining projects. Key job responsibilities Key Responsibilities: - Program Management: - Develop and maintain comprehensive product launch schedules and roadmaps - Create and track program milestones, dependencies, and critical paths - Identify and manage risks, creating mitigation strategies proactively - Lead cross-functional meetings and drive decision-making processes - Product Launch Management - Orchestrate end-to-end product launch activities across all departments - Coordinate launch materials, and customer-facing collateral - Establish launch metrics and track success criteria - Beta Program Management - Design and execute beta programs with key customers - Collect and analyze feedback from beta participants - Manage beta customer relationships and expectations - Translate beta insights into actionable product improvements - Stakeholder Management - Maintain clear communication channels with internal teams and external partners - Create and distribute regular status updates to all stakeholders - Align sales and marketing teams on product positioning and timing - Work with customer success teams to ensure smooth customer adoption About the team About AWS Diverse Experiences AWS values diverse experiences. Basic Qualifications - 7+ years of people management experience - 7+ years of technical program management experience - Bachelor's degree in Engineering, Computer Science, or a related technical field - Experience in technical program management - Experience managing projects across cross functional teams, building sustainable processes and coordinating release schedules Preferred Qualifications - 7+ years of work in internet-related program or technical product management in a software applications environment experience - Knowledge of cloud computing services or deployment architecture - Experience working in an internet-related program or technical product management in a software applications environment - Experience communicating across technical and non-technical audiences, including executive level stakeholders or clients - Experience with agile or other program management methodologies Amazon is an equal opportunity employer and does not discriminate on the basis of protected veteran status, disability, or other legally protected status. At Amazon, it’s always “Day 1.” Now, what does this mean and why does it matter? It means that our approach remains the same as it was on Amazon’s very first day – to make smart, fast decisions, stay nimble, invent, and stay focused on delighting our customers. In our 2016 shareholder letter, Amazon CEO Jeff Bezos shared his thoughts on how to keep up a Day 1 company mindset. “Staying in Day 1 requires you to experiment patiently, accept failures, plant seeds, protect saplings, and double down when you see customer delight,” he wrote. “A customer-obsessed culture best creates the conditions where all of that can happen.” You can read the full letter here
